The blaugrana midfielder bids farewell to his boyhood club in an emotional appearance at the Auditori 1899

More than half a lifetime in blaugrana. Sergi Roberto came to FC Barcelona in 2006, fulfilling a lifelong dream to wear the Barça jersey as he moves through the youth teams at La Masia to become captain of the first team, following on from fellow legends such as Carles Puyol, Xavi Hernández, Andrés Iniesta and Leo Messi. 

On Tuesday at the Auditori 1899 at Spotify Camp Nou, the Catalan footballer brought his Barça career to a close with a farewell event attended by his teammates, members of the Board of Directors and, of course, friends and family. 

Versatile, generous and a club legend 

A lifelong Barça man, Sergi Roberto won 25 trophies as a blaugrana in more than 350 appearances for the first team. The man from Reus leaves the club after 18 years and a first team debut that took place back in November 2010.

Since that day there have been many unforgettable moments with perhaps the most remembered his goal to make the score 6-1 in the famous Champions League second leg comeback against Paris Saint-Germain. 

"Barça is and always will be me my club"

After an emotional beginning and a video bringing together all of the highlights from his blaugrana career, Sergi Roberto appeared on stage to address the watching crowd. It is never easy to say goodbye and this was certainly the case for the midfielder as he looked back on farewells from past team mates, pointing out that "now it is my turn." 

The local boy from the south of Catalonia remembered his arrival at La Masia, "the best years of my life", adding that "it allowed me to grow as a person and a player...La Masia is the heart of this club." 

With tears in his eyes, he recalled the support of the fans, admitting to be "eternally grateful" for their motivating role in producing "unforgettable moments." Roberto ended his speech with praise for his family which did not leave a dry eye in the house. 

"I can only say thank you"

As a culer, there are always tough days and Sergi Roberto's farewell is surely one of those. President Laporta summed it up saying: "Sergi Roberto has been an example. I can only say thank you for your commitment and your gratitude. Barça is, and always will be, your home."
